Output 632940b10a4d2308f1565236798eee31c191665b0435ae73e91d537c8e642163:18

value
83177601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61db72dcaaeb08a3d38e1e853bbf7423facf6763 OP_EQUAL
address
MGpafbiKYjMSNR2Pnc7ZFyDVu4PfJ9gAbe
transaction
632940b10a4d2308f1565236798eee31c191665b0435ae73e91d537c8e642163
spent
true